Output 6312cc1373487a7dbff27883903c375aa945d22622a09ce7edf8a4378f346045:0

value
17613354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c53bf36e727fafe27dfe3ed0893c16e6ec5904f OP_EQUAL
address
3FwbfJpjqukfKAzrsnVtCJDJXwHa1Hcsrx
transaction
6312cc1373487a7dbff27883903c375aa945d22622a09ce7edf8a4378f346045